Elon Musk on Wednesday urged a federal judge not to prevent him from publicly discussing a lawsuit accusing him of deceiving Tesla Inc shareholders by tweeting in 2018 about taking his electric car company private.

The shareholders' request"evokes a level of censorship entirely incompatible with our justice system and the basic tenets of free speech," lawyers for Tesla and Musk wrote. Their request came after they said US District Judge Edward Chen agreed with them that the tweet was"false and misleading."
